Join a brand new branch in the stunning Far North area - Kerikeri/Waipapa

Citycare Property, a proudly New Zealand-owned company with a rich legacy spanning over two decades, is excited to extend its reach to the Far North Region.

We are a seeking a committed Structures Serviceperson to join our team. This role involves meticulous playground equipment maintenance, including inspections, fault reporting, and minor repairs. You'll also be responsible for maintaining bark mulch to contract standards, tending to general maintenance tasks, and preserving timber structures. We are after someone who can effectively communicate with their supervisor, skilfully operate machinery, and manage their time effectively. Are you passionate about your work? Do you guarantee playground safety while upholding professionalism and customer satisfaction? We want to hear from

The role will be located in Kerikeri/Waipapa but will cover the whole Far North region. Hours are work are Monday to Friday 40 hours.
